Ukraine's manipulations with delaying the deadlines for fulfilling agreements with Russia are related to internal factors and Kiev's relations with its sponsors, Rodion Miroshnik, Ambassador-at-large of the Russian Foreign Ministry, told Izvestia. Experts add that the current Ukrainian authorities are afraid of image losses that will increase discontent in the country. On June 9, Russia and Ukraine conducted the first exchange of prisoners under the age of 25, although an agreement on this was reached in Istanbul a week ago. Moscow also conveyed to Kiev in advance the proposal to transfer the bodies of the dead soldiers. However, Kiev has not accepted its soldiers. Against this background, the Foreign Ministers of Russia and Belarus will discuss the situation around Ukraine. The progress in the implementation of the agreements reached in Istanbul can be found in the Izvestia article.

How are the humanitarian agreements between Moscow and Kiev being implemented

Russia and Ukraine conducted the first exchange of prisoners under the age of 25 in accordance with the agreements reached by the parties on June 2 in Istanbul during the negotiations of the delegations. Russian military personnel are currently on the territory of Belarus, where they are receiving the necessary psychological and medical assistance, the Russian Defense Ministry said.

At the same time, Kiev has not received the bodies of its dead soldiers. Recall that on June 7, Ukraine postponed this procedure indefinitely, said Vladimir Medinsky, assistant to the President and head of the Russian delegation.

Russian representatives are still in the exchange area and are ready to hand over the bodies of the dead soldiers of the Armed Forces of Ukraine. This was stated on June 9 at a briefing by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ov, answering a question from Izvestia.

Rodion Miroshnik, the Russian Foreign Ministry's ambassador-at-large for crimes committed by the Kiev regime, told Izvestia that the Russian Federation had fully implemented the agreements, the ball was on the Ukrainian side and Kiev was responsible for the official reaction to the humanitarian act proposed by Russia.

— We state that the agreements have been fully implemented on the Russian side. Kiev's manipulations are carried out regardless of the negotiations. This is influenced by some internal factors or by Ukraine's external relations with its sponsors," Miroshnik explained to Izvestia.

After the second round of negotiations between the Russian and Ukrainian delegations in Istanbul on June 2, it became known that the Russian Federation would hand over the bodies of 6,000 dead Ukrainian soldiers and accept the bodies of Russian soldiers if Ukraine had them. The parties also reached an agreement on a large-scale exchange of prisoners of war, which will include seriously ill people and people under the age of 25. It was about the mutual transfer of 1,000 to 1,2 thousand people.

Ukraine's failure to receive the bodies of its dead soldiers is regrettable, Milan Mazurek, a member of the European Parliament (EP), told Izvestia. Taking care of the remains of fallen soldiers is one of the most important duties of any state, he stressed.

— It is difficult for me to imagine that only such exchanges of opinions could resolve the conflict. However, I sincerely hope that both sides will show respect to the victims and their families. First of all, I hope that this senseless violence will stop as soon as possible," the politician told Izvestia.

The Ukrainian authorities do not want to accept the bodies of their soldiers, due to the fact that such a number of dead shatters all the narratives promoted by Ukrainian propaganda. In addition, most of the transferred soldiers died in the Kursk area, where the fighting was Zelensky's personal initiative, former deputy of the Verkhovna Rada of Ukraine Spiridon Kilinkarov told Izvestia.

"I am convinced that they will try to stretch this procedure as long as possible, question it, conduct a lot of examinations, and take this topic somewhere into the shadows so that Ukrainians do not focus their attention on it," he said.

Prospects for the third round of negotiations between Russia and Ukraine

The dates of the third round of negotiations between Moscow and Kiev have not yet been determined, but it is known that Ukraine had previously offered to arrange another meeting in the period from June 20 to June 30. Russia will continue the conversation, despite the terrorist nature of the Kiev regime. This was stated on June 9 by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ov, answering a question from Izvestia about the form in which the parties to the negotiations would respond to the memoranda.

— We will certainly talk about continuing conversations. <...> [Russian Foreign Minister] Sergey Viktorovich Lavrov expressed his point of view, where he said that <...>.."nevertheless, it is necessary to continue contacts at the working level, and the President [of Russia Vladimir Putin] agreed with this," Peskov stressed.

Agreements on a new round of dialogue are being reached by the negotiating teams. These are negotiations on negotiations, when the parties agree on the most convenient option for them to transmit answers through appropriate channels, Rodion Miroshnik clarified in an interview with Izvestia.

Against this background, Maxim Ryzhenkov, the Minister of Foreign Affairs of Belarus, arrived in Moscow on June 9. He planned to exchange views on the situation around Ukraine with his Russian counterpart Sergey Lavrov. One of the main topics of the talks scheduled for June 10 could also be the humanitarian component of the dialogue between Russia and Ukraine. It is important that the return of the Russian military takes place through the Belarusian territory.

The exchange of prisoners and bodies of the dead is always something that precedes the main agreements on the settlement of the conflict. In this way, the parties are trying to neutralize the most acute moments of the confrontation and demonstrate their willingness to continue the discussion. At the same time, the main topics of the conflict, such as the neutral status of Ukraine and territorial issues, cannot be resolved by Kiev on its own, concluded Natalia Yeremina, Professor at St. Petersburg State University.

It is known that the Russian version of the memorandum contains a clause on the international legal recognition of Crimea, the LPR, the DPR, the Zaporizhia and Kherson regions as part of the Russian Federation, and the withdrawal of Ukrainian armed formations from their territories. In addition, the document contains a provision on Ukraine's neutrality, which implies its refusal to join military alliances and coalitions, as well as the deployment of foreign troops and infrastructure on its territory. Kiev stated in its version of the memorandum that it was not going to commit to renouncing membership in NATO and the EU. Ukrainians expect an immediate 30-day truce with the possibility of extension, the line of demarcation will have to be held by the United States and third countries. Kiev is ready to discuss territorial issues only after a complete and unconditional ceasefire.
